Who?
Abelardo Morell creates images that are called camera obscura. Camera Obscura means dark chamber (room). In a regular room, Morell puts black plastic over all the windows to make it completely dark but leaves a tiny hole in one of the windows for light to pass through. The result is the outside world reflected upside down on the wall and a combined outdoor image with the indoor image. Morell also takes pictures of household objects as if it were seen through the eyes of his son, Brady, to show how children see the adult world. With his subjects and styles, Morell’s pictures always make you think about how things are and how we see them.

Why?
In this photo, the Hotel del Coronado is reflected onto an inside wall. The image is upside down because light rays travel in a straight line. When light from the bottom of an object travels through a small opening, it will show at the top of the wall. When light from the top of an object travels through a small opening, it will show at the bottom of the wall. This makes the final image upside down.

Glossary terms
Camera Obscura - The original camera obscura was a large, walk-in room pierced with a single, small hole in one of its four walls. Light rays from a bright object outside of the camera obscura enter the small hole and an inverted image appears on the opposite wall.
